A POST Office in Glasgow has reopened after seven months following a major refurbishment. 

Peterson Park Post Office, on Yokermill Road, reopened on Thursday, April 13 following the transformation of the entire shop which was undertaken by the new Postmaster. 

It had been temporarily closed since mid-September due to the extensive building work to modernise the premises throughout.

The branch is now a Nisa Local store with a much wider range of stock and customers are able to access Post Office services at a serving point integrated with the retail counter.

The new opening hours are from 9am to 5.30pm Monday to Friday, and from 9am to 12.30pm on Saturday and it no longer closes at lunchtime.

Scott Hamilton, Post Office network provision lead, said: "We apologise for any inconvenience caused to our customers during the work.

"The new-look shop and Post Office look fantastic – such a transformation.

"The branch is now open longer too and there is a much wider range of stock."

Peterson Park Post Office is located at 14 Yokermill Road.
